    Petition calls for Griffith Middle School name change over racism

    A petition inspired by UTLA social justice activist Jose Lara is calling for the immediate removal of the name D.W. Griffith from an East Los Angeles middle school because his 1915 film, “The Birth of a Nation,” celebrated the Ku Klux Klan. The demand follows nationwide calls for the removal of Confederate flags from public spaces in the aftermath of...
